Con el objetivo de informar, advertir y ayudar a los profesionales sobre las últimas vulnerabilidades de seguridad en sistemas tecnológicos, ponemos a disposición de los usuarios interesados en esta información una base de datos con información en castellano sobre cada una de las últimas vulnerabilidades documentadas y conocidas.

Este repositorio con más de 75.000 registros esta basado en la información de NVD (National Vulnerability Database) – en función de un acuerdo de colaboración – por el cual desde INCIBE realizamos la traducción al castellano de la información incluida. En ocasiones este listado mostrará vulnerabilidades que aún no han sido traducidas debido a que se recogen en el transcurso del tiempo en el que el equipo de INCIBE realiza el proceso de traducción.

Se emplea el estándar de nomenclatura de vulnerabilidades CVE (Common Vulnerabilities and Exposures), con el fin de facilitar el intercambio de información entre diferentes bases de datos y herramientas. Cada una de las vulnerabilidades recogidas enlaza a diversas fuentes de información así como a parches disponibles o soluciones aportadas por los fabricantes y desarrolladores. Es posible realizar búsquedas avanzadas teniendo la opción de seleccionar diferentes criterios como el tipo de vulnerabilidad, fabricante, tipo de impacto entre otros, con el fin de acortar los resultados.

Mediante suscripción RSS o Boletines podemos estar informados diariamente de las últimas vulnerabilidades incorporadas al repositorio.

*** Pendiente de traducción *** n8n is an open source workflow automation platform. Prior to versions 1.123.33 and 2.17.5, the dynamic-node-parameters endpoints did not verify whether the authenticated caller was authorized to use a supplied credential reference. An authenticated user with access to a shared workflow could supply a foreign credential ID in the request body, causing the backend to decrypt and use that credential in a helper execution path where the caller also controls the destination URL. This allowed the caller to force the backend to authenticate against attacker-controlled infrastructure using a credential belonging to another user, effectively exfiltrating a reusable API key. The issue is not limited to any single node type; any node that resolves credentials dynamically through these endpoints may be affected. This issue has been patched in versions 1.123.33, 2.17.5, and 2.18.0.

*** Pendiente de traducción *** Prometheus is an open-source monitoring system and time series database. Prior to versions 3.5.3 and 3.11.3, the client_secret field in the Azure AD remote write OAuth configuration (storage/remote/azuread) was typed as string instead of Secret. Prometheus redacts fields of type Secret when serving the configuration via the /-/config HTTP API endpoint. Because the field was a plain string, the Azure OAuth client secret was exposed in plaintext to any user or process with access to that endpoint. This issue has been patched in versions 3.5.3 and 3.11.3.

*** Pendiente de traducción *** Prometheus is an open-source monitoring system and time series database. Prior to versions 3.5.3 and 3.11.3, the remote read endpoint (/api/v1/read) does not validate the declared decoded length in a snappy-compressed request body before allocating memory. An unauthenticated attacker can send a small payload that causes a huge heap allocation per request. Under concurrent load this can exhaust available memory and crash the Prometheus process. This issue has been patched in versions 3.5.3 and 3.11.3.

*** Pendiente de traducción *** Claude SDK for TypeScript provides access to the Claude API from server-side TypeScript or JavaScript applications. From version 0.79.0 to before version 0.91.1, the BetaLocalFilesystemMemoryTool in the Anthropic TypeScript SDK created memory files and directories using the Node.js default modes (0o666 for files, 0o777 for directories), leaving them world-readable on systems with a standard umask and world-writable in environments with a permissive umask such as many Docker base images. A local attacker on a shared host could read persisted agent state, and in containerized deployments could modify memory files to influence subsequent model behavior. This issue has been patched in version 0.91.1.

*** Pendiente de traducción *** Conditional Fields for Contact Form 7 WordPress plugin through version 2.6.7 contains an uncontrolled resource consumption vulnerability in the Wpcf7cfMailParser class where the hide_hidden_mail_fields_regex_callback() method reads an iteration count directly from user-supplied POST parameters without validation or upper bound enforcement. Unauthenticated attackers can supply an arbitrarily large integer value through the REST API endpoint to cause unbounded loop execution with multiple preg_replace() operations, exhausting server memory and crashing the PHP process.

*** Pendiente de traducción *** Arelle before 2.39.10 contains an unauthenticated remote code execution vulnerability in the /rest/configure REST endpoint that accepts a plugins query parameter and forwards it to the plugin manager without authentication or authorization. Attackers can supply a URL to a malicious Python file through the plugins parameter, causing the Arelle webserver to download and execute the attacker-controlled code within the Arelle process with its privileges.

*** Pendiente de traducción *** Detect-It-Easy prior to 3.21 contains a path traversal vulnerability that allows attackers to write arbitrary files to the filesystem by crafting malicious archive entries with relative traversal sequences or absolute paths. Attackers can exploit insufficient path normalization during archive extraction to write files outside the intended extraction directory and achieve persistent code execution by overwriting user startup scripts.

*** Pendiente de traducción *** titra is an open source time tracking project. In version 0.99.52, the globalsettings Meteor publication returns all global settings without any admin or role check. Any authenticated user can subscribe via DDP and receive sensitive configuration fields such as google_secret, openai_apikey, and google_clientid. At time of publication no public patch is available.

*** Pendiente de traducción *** PlantUML Macro is a macro for rendering UML diagrams from simple textual schemes. Prior to version 2.4.1, the PlantUML Macro is vulnerable to Server-Side Request Forgery (SSRF). The macro allows users to specify an alternative PlantUML server via the server parameter. However, the application does not validate the supplied URL. An attacker can supply an internal IP address or a malicious external URL. The XWiki server will attempt to connect to this URL to "render" the diagram. This issue has been patched in version 2.4.1.

*** Pendiente de traducción *** CImg Library is a C++ library for image processing. Prior to commit 4ca26bc, there is an integer overflow vulnerability in the W*H*D size computation inside _load_pnm() that can bypass the memory allocation guard. A crafted PNM/PGM/PPM file with large dimension values causes the overflow to wrap around, allocating an undersized buffer and potentially triggering a heap buffer overflow. Any application using CImg to load untrusted image files is affected. This issue has been patched via commit 4ca26bc.

*** Pendiente de traducción *** CImg Library is a C++ library for image processing. Prior to commit c3aacf5, the nb_colors field read from the BMP file header is used directly to compute an allocation size without validating it against the remaining file size. A crafted BMP file with a large nb_colors value triggers an out-of-memory condition, crashing any application that uses CImg to load untrusted BMP files. This issue has been patched via commit c3aacf5.
